Pharmaceutical Membrane Filters Market Overview
The pharmaceutical membrane filters market is currently on a significant growth trajectory, fueled by the rising demand for biopharmaceuticals and the necessity for advanced filtration technologies. Industry analyses reveal that this market could exceed USD 20.05 billion, exhibiting a promising compound annual growth rate (CAGR) of 13.1% over the coming years.

Surge in Biopharmaceutical Demand
The biopharmaceutical sector significantly influences the demand for pharmaceutical membrane filters as it includes sensitive compounds like monoclonal antibodies and vaccines. These high-molecular-weight substances require precise manufacturing processes to ensure efficacy and safety. Consequently, a rise in biologic drug pipelines necessitates advanced membrane filtration technologies to maintain uncompromised quality.

Market Segmentation
The market can be segmented into various categories:
- By Technology: The market is divided into microfiltration, ultrafiltration, reverse osmosis, and nanofiltration, with microfiltration holding the largest market share in recent analyses.
- By Design: Key design segments include spiral wounds, tubular systems, hollow fibers, and plates & frames, where the hollow fiber system is currently leading.
- By Material: Materials such as polyethersulfone (PES), polysulfone (PS), cellulose-based, PTFE, PVC, and polyacrylonitrile (PAN) are commonly used, with PES dominating the sector.
- By End User: The primary segments comprise pharmaceutical and biotech industries, CROs, and CDMOs, with the pharmaceutical and biotech industries commanding the largest share.
